Update Travis CI build badge/docs after migration
Update badge URL in readme after migrating from travis-ci.org to travis-ci.com, due to brownout on the former. Migration was performed via Travis Web UI: https://docs.travis-ci.com/user/migrate/open-source-repository-migration NOTE: This is a quick fix to speed up Travis builds until we switch to GitHub Actions (#1195) Signed-off-by: Lukas Puehringer <lukas.puehringer@nyu.edu>
